## Step 4: Ship the ledger service

OK, almost there. Once the PointsKeeper ledger migration passes dry-run on staging, bump the chart version and tag the release. Double-check that the reconciliation job is paused — last time Marisol's team at Bramblewick forgot and we double-credited a bunch of loyalty accounts, which was... not fun to unwind. Deploys to the ledger tier must be signed before the rollout controller will accept them. The deploy key for the signing step is as follows.

rollout seal: bky3_MEi

Runbook: Account Recovery — Quillgate WS Reconnect Bug

Known issue: Quillgate's websocket client drops reconnect attempts after an account recovery flow resets the session token. Symptom: dashboard stuck on "reconnecting" loop. Fix: flush the session cache on gate-02, then force a token refresh before the client retries. Do not restart the relay; it masks the bug. If the user remains locked out, initiate manual recovery via the Hollis console. You will need the recovery passphrase below.

unlock words, tawif-tahop: oliys-ulawyn-tamdor-lamys-casox-jormir-fraius-kasath-ulador-ulamir-holir-sorys-holeth

Partitions are created two months ahead by the
# scheduler and dropped only after the retention window expires and the
# archival checksum is verified. Note for reviewers: dropping a partition
# bypasses row-level delete triggers, so retention values here are
# security-relevant, not just performance tuning. The constants governing
# creation lead time, retention, and lock timeouts are defined below.

constants for tageg-kagag:
QUOTAS = {
    "kelax": 495,
    "istath": 366,
    "tammir": 108,
    "novdor": 730,
    "casax": 816,
    "quenael": 874,
    "pelius": 403,
}

Hey Marisol — handing off the Kestrelgate token bug before I'm out. Sessions refreshed twice when the clock skewed past 30s, so users got bounced mid-checkout. Fix is in the refresh middleware; patched build is on staging and looks solid. Dario has context if QA flags anything. For the release notes, these are the staging values the fix was verified against.

settings of fafog-haduf:
ZORIX_PIN=4648
ZORIX_METRICS_HOST=metrics.zorix.paliqsys.corp
ZORIX_LOG_LEVEL=info
ZORIX_TENANT=druix